I tried receiving some PSK31 using a FSK31 demodulator last night with the 
hope that maybe it would decode something, but no joy.  However, a FSK 
demodulator should nearly as easy to implement as a CW 
detector/converter.  You could come up with something the size of the MFJ 
CW reader with its small display. However, again, who would you talk 
to?  There's currently no FSK31 on the air.  Make it also do PSK31, then 
you could use it with the Dave Benson's Small Wonder PSK31 series, the K2 
or similar portable rigs.  Have provision to plug in regular keyboard.  I 
have a 11" regular keyboard I use for portable operations.  There probably 
would be a good market for a converter/display like that.  Why tie it to 
the KX1, or FSK31?
